The recent ISS air leak emergency evacuation has garnered significant attention as five astronauts were forced to take shelter inside their spacecraft. This precautionary measure comes in response to alarming leaks detected in the Russian segment of the International Space Station (ISS), specifically within the Zvezda module. As concerns grow over the safety of the crew, NASA has stepped in to ensure their protection amid ongoing repair attempts.

On June 5, 2026, the leak was initially identified in a transfer tunnel connected to the Zvezda module, prompting Russian space agency Roscosmos to assess the situation further and implement emergency protocols. According to NASA Press Secretary Bethany Stevens, the agency directed the SpaceX Crew-12 astronauts and NASA astronaut Chris Williams to “assume an elevated safety posture” in the Dragon spacecraft during the repairs.

What Happened During the Emergency Evacuation?

All four Crew-12 astronauts—including NASA’s Jessica Meir and Jack Hathaway, European Space Agency’s Sophie Adenot, and Roscosmos cosmonaut Andrey Fedyaev—were instructed to seek refuge inside the SpaceX Dragon capsule after two potential leaks were discovered. The order was briefly lifted later that day as Roscosmos paused the structural repair efforts to gather more information.

Despite the alarming detection of leaks, Roscosmos reported that the situation did not pose an immediate threat to the astronauts. During a routine inspection, the Russian specialists identified these issues as part of an ongoing concern that has been monitored since 2019. Over the years, measures have been taken to repair similar leaks, but these latest developments indicate that the problem may have worsened over time.

The Ongoing Concerns of ISS Reliability

The ISS has been in operation for over 25 years and is crucial for international cooperation in space exploration. However, the increasing frequency of leaks has raised questions about its reliability and how it will impact future missions. This incident serves to highlight the delicate nature of space operations, where any disrepair can lead to critical danger for astronauts onboard.

The ongoing issues with air leaks on the ISS are not new. Previously, NASA indicated that the leaks posed a risk of “catastrophic failure.” Efforts to repair such leaks often involve meticulous work on microscopic cracks, which are challenging to diagnose and fix. Although these repairs have been attempted successfully in the past, the recent resurgence in leak issues has sparked deeper discussions about the future of the ISS.

Future Implications for Space Exploration

With the end of this iconic space laboratory looming, there are ongoing discussions about its future. NASA has plans to sustain operations through 2030, but uncertainty remains as Russia has not committed beyond 2028. A withdrawal by Russia could have significant ramifications for joint missions and collaboration, particularly in managing the ISS’s upkeep.

This incident underscores the importance of maintaining a presence in low-Earth orbit, especially with global rivals like China continuing to advance their own space initiatives. The ISS is seen as a vital stepping stone for aspiring missions targeting the Moon and Mars under NASA’s Artemis program.

As future plans unfold, NASA continues to evaluate options for a replacement station. In earlier discussions, transitioning to a private-sector alternative had emerged as a prominent agenda, but reliance on commercial partners has since caused shifts in strategy.
